一、并发能力与带宽的关联性
服务器并发能力指同时处理请求的最大数量,其与带宽的关系可通过以下公式计算:带宽 = (单请求数据量 × 并发数 × 8) / 响应时间。例如当 2400 用户同时访问 30KB 页面时,按 20 秒响应时间计算,所需带宽约为 10Mbps。影响并发能力的核心因素包括:
- 用户行为特征:突发流量与持续访问的差异
- 内容类型:文本请求与视频流量的带宽消耗比可达 1:1000
- 连接保持时间:TCP 长连接对资源的占用效应
二、流量估算的核心参数
精准的流量估算需整合多维数据指标,基础计算模型为:总流量 = 页面大小 × 日均PV × 月天数。以电商网站为例,单个用户访问产生 5MB 流量时,日访问量 10 万次对应月流量需求 1.5TB。关键参数包括:
- 平均页面大小:需包含 HTML/CSS/JS 等静态资源
- 用户访问深度:多页面跳转产生的累积流量
- 文件下载量:独立于页面访问的特殊传输需求
三、冗余系数的设计原则
冗余系数用于应对突发流量和系统容错,典型取值范围为 1.3-1.8。设计时需考虑:
业务类型 | 推荐系数 | 适用场景 |
---|---|---|
静态网站 | 1.3-1.5 | 访问波动较小的企业官网 |
视频平台 | 1.6-1.8 | 存在热门内容引爆流量的场景 |
冗余设计需结合历史流量峰值数据,例如某下载站采用 1.5 倍冗余后,成功应对了超出日常 40% 的突发访问。
服务器带宽计算需构建三位一体的评估体系:通过并发测试确定基础容量,基于流量模型预测常态需求,最后叠加冗余系数保障系统弹性。实际应用中,建议采用动态监测与定期校准相结合的方式,例如使用云服务商的带宽监控工具实现实时调整。